FATV Weekly Highlights
Fitchburg Access Television (FATV) will kick off its programming with an exciting live broadcast of the boys’ basketball game between Fitchburg High School (FHS) and Wachusett Regional High School on Friday at 19:00. This event also marks Senior Night, celebrating the achievements of graduating players. Viewers can tune in on the public channel via Comcast 8 or Verizon 35.
Additionally, FATV has scheduled a range of programs throughout the week. Highlights include “Chess Chat” on Monday at 19:00 and “Inside Fitchburg” on Wednesday at 19:00. Other notable broadcasts include the “Poetry Podcast” on Saturday at 20:00. For government-related programming, viewers can catch live sessions of the School Committee on Monday at 18:00 and the City Council meeting on Tuesday at 19:00. Complete scheduling can be found on FATV’s website, fatv.org, which also offers on-demand videos and live streaming options.
Leominster.TV Programming Schedule
Leominster.TV will also provide a rich lineup of shows this week, with highlights including “Barbara and You” on Monday at 17:00 and “Inside Leominster-Live” on Thursday at 16:00. The channel offers various programming throughout the week, including “Good Animation” on weekdays at 07:30, and “Fit for Life” on Sundays at 09:30. City Council meetings will occur on the second Monday of the month at 18:45, with meetings available for viewing on their website at leominster.tv.
Regularly scheduled meetings, such as the Conservation Commission on January 27 and the Planning Board on February 2, ensure that residents stay informed about local governance. For further details and additional programming, visit the Leominster.TV website.
Lunenburg Public Access (PAC) Highlights
In Lunenburg, PAC will be broadcasting a variety of local content, including the School Committee meeting on Monday at 17:00 and the Finance Committee on Friday at 09:00. The public channel will also air “Mary Surratt” on Wednesday at 19:30, alongside a weekly Book Club on Monday at 20:00.
For educational content, “Tree Kim’s Art Show” will be featured on Monday at 15:30, while “Lunenburg Storytime – The Books We Love” will air daily at 16:00 and 19:00. Comcast channels offer viewers a chance to engage with their community and explore local interests.
